About the Role
The purpose of this position is to undertake a variety of operational works using plant and machinery to deliver routine maintenance of Council’s assets and infrastructure within the Parks & Open Spaces. The role involves maintenance of our open space parks and reserves. Using a ride on mower, driving a truck and trailer, mowing, basic parks maintenance, pruning and gardening.
About Us
Wingecarribee Shire Council is the Local Government Authority (LGA) for the beautiful Southern Highlands of New South Wales. We are a thriving regional centre located midway between Sydney, Canberra and Wollongong and is a recognised place of arts, culture and style for our visitors and our community.
